A small community-based school in the Kimberley seeks a Wellbeing Services Coordinator to significantly contribute to the improvement of student health and wellbeing.
Situated roughly 3 hours from Derby, your role will involve close collaboration with residential mentors, teachers, parents/carers, and community stakeholders to guarantee every student has the chance to achieve their utmost potential.
We are dedicated to empowering Indigenous students to chart their own paths of progress and secure a significant, impactful place within their communities and the broader Australian society.
The educational model embraces the Two-Way learning principle, recognizing educators as both instructors and learners – gaining insights from students, the land, the local community, local Elders, and their colleagues. The emphasis on "On Country" learning, guided by the 8 Aboriginal Ways of Learning, fosters experiential learning deeply connected to traditional practices, the local environment, culture, and community.
